The Congress of South African Trade Unions (COSATU) is set to stage a picket today outside the North Gauteng High Court, in support for the Department of Health in the ongoing legal battle over the National Health Insurance (NHI) Act. This court case, initiated by the Board of Healthcare Funders (BHF) and the South African Private Practitioners' Forum (SAPPF), seeks to overturn President Cyril Ramaphosa's decision to sign the NHI into law, citing concerns over its constitutionality. To delve deeper into this contentious issue Elvis Presslin spoke to COSATU spokesperson, Zanele Sabela
